免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

小程序链接解析

小程序是近年来兴起的一种轻量级应用,它不需要安装,可以直接在微信、支付宝等应用内运行。小程序的链接解析指的是将小程序的链接转换为可以在浏览器中打开的链接,或者将小程序的链接转换为二维码。本文将从小程序链接的组成、小程序链接的解析原理以及小程序链接解析的应用场景三个方面进行介绍。

一、小程序链接的组成

小程序链接由三部分组成:协议、路径和参数。其中,协议是指小程序链接的协议类型,一般为https或者http。路径是指小程序的路径,可以理解为小程序的页面地址。参数是指小程序的额外参数,用于向小程序传递数据。

二、小程序链接的解析原理

小程序链接的解析原理主要涉及到两个方面:小程序的打开方式和小程序链接的转换。

1.小程序的打开方式

小程序可以通过两种方式打开:一种是通过微信、支付宝等应用内直接打开,另一种是通过小程序的链接在浏览器中打开。

在应用内打开小程序时,应用会根据小程序的AppID和路径信息,打开相应的小程序页面。而在浏览器中打开小程序时,需要将小程序链接转换为可以在浏览器中打开的链接。这时候就需要用到小程序链接的转换。

2.小程序链接的转换

小程序链接的转换是指将小程序的链接转换为可以在浏览器中打开的链接,或者将小程序的链接转换为二维码。

一般来说,小程序链接的转换可以通过第三方工具或者API实现。具体的转换过程包括以下几个步骤:

(1)获取小程序的AppID和路径信息。

(2)将AppID和路径信息拼接成小程序链接。

(3)通过第三方工具或者API将小程序链接转换为可以在浏览器中打开的链接或者二维码。

(4)将转换后的链接或者二维码分享给其他人使用。

三、小程序链接解析的应用场景

小程序链接解析有很多应用场景,下面列举几个常见的应用场景。

1.分享小程序链接

小程序链接解析可以将小程序链接转换为可以在浏览器中打开的链接或者二维码,方便用户在不同的平台上分享小程序链接。

2.小程序推广

通过将小程序链接转换为可以在浏览器中打开的链接或者二维码,可以方便地将小程序推广到更多的用户。这对于小程序的推广非常有帮助。

3.小程序数据采集

通过小程序链接解析,可以获取小程序的AppID和路径信息,从而方便进行小程序的数据采集和分析。

总之,小程序链接解析是小程序开发中非常重要的一部分,它可以方便地将小程序分享到不同的平台上,同时也方便了小程序的推广和数据采集。


相关知识:
阿克苏装修报价小程序开发工程
阿克苏装修报价小程序是一款便捷的家居装修报价工具,用户通过该小程序可以随时随地获取装修报价信息,以便更好地规划自己的装修预算。本文将简要介绍阿克苏装修报价小程序的开发原理和实现过程。一、开发原理阿克苏装修报价小程序的开发基于微信小程序开发技术和数据接口,其
2023-08-09
安装小程序开发工具导致上不了网
在做小程序开发的过程中,我们需要使用小程序开发工具来进行开发和调试,但是有时候我们可能会遇到一个问题,就是在安装了小程序开发工具之后,在电脑上上不了网。这是为什么呢?下面我们来详细介绍一下这个问题的原理和解决方法。1.原理介绍在安装小程序开发工具之后,有时
2023-08-09
安徽网站建设小程序开发
安徽网站建设小程序开发是近年来风靡全国的一种新型应用程序。在互联网时代,越来越多的人和企业开始将自己的业务扩展到移动端,小程序开发成为了他们扩展业务的最佳选择。无论是大或小企业,都需要一款高质量的小程序,以提高企业的竞争力。本文将从原理和详细介绍两个方面,
2023-08-09
安徽微信小程序开发哪家强
微信小程序是一种轻量级的应用程序,运行在微信客户端中,用户无需下载安装即可使用。微信小程序在短时间内便已经在社交媒体、电商、金融等领域相关企业得到广泛应用。安徽地区也早已经涌现出很多优秀的小程序开发公司,本文将为大家介绍安徽微信小程序开发哪家强。一、合肥媒
2023-08-09
安庆在线教育平台小程序开发
安庆在线教育平台是一个专注于为学生提供在线学习资源的平台。随着移动互联网的发展,安庆在线教育平台更是推出了自己的小程序。本文将简要介绍安庆在线教育平台小程序的开发原理和详细过程。一、小程序开发原理小程序是一种新型的应用程序,它是在微信、支付宝等平台内运行的
2023-08-09
uniapp开发小程序遇到的问题
Uniapp是一个跨平台开发框架,可用于开发小程序、H5、APP等多个平台。由于其强大的跨平台能力,使得开发者在开发过程中遇到的问题更加复杂,下面将会介绍一些在开发小程序过程中可能会遇到的问题和解决方法。问题一:小程序不能获取到用户授权信息解决方法:1.在
2023-08-09
php企业小程序开发
PHP企业小程序开发是一种基于PHP语言的轻量级应用程序。它利用微信公众号的开发接口,将企业业务与微信生态连接起来,为企业提供了一种轻便、高效、实用的客户端服务。PHP企业小程序主要分为后台管理和前端展示两部分,下面我们将分别进行介绍。一、后台管理1.权限
2023-08-09
cocos开发头条小程序
Cocos是一个用于游戏开发的开源框架,支持多种编程语言和平台,包括Cocos2d-x, Cocos Creator, Cocos2d-JS和Cocos2d-html5等。在这些框架中,Cocos Creator是一款支持跨平台开发的集成开发环境,通过它可
2023-08-09
buy拼购小程序开发
随着电商的快速发展,拼购已成为电商行业的一大趋势。拼购,就是将多个用户的需求和购买力集中起来,以最小的单价获取最大的单量,从而达到降低成本、增加销量的效果。随着移动互联网的普及和智能手机的普及,拼购APP和小程序的兴起不断推动着拼购的发展。下面,我们来详细
2023-08-09
android小程序开发需要多久
Android 小程序是由 Google 推出的一种轻量级应用程序,它可以借助 Android 平台的优势来实现快速的开发和运行。开发 Android 小程序主要涉及到以下技术:Java、Kotlin、XML 等。Android 开发平台提供了完善的工具和
2023-08-09
小程序二次开发工具
小程序二次开发工具是一种通过对原有小程序进行重新开发或重构,以达到修改、优化、定制等目的的工具,也可以称为小程序定制开发工具。它可以通过对小程序源代码的加工处理来实现相应的需求,比如增加原本没有的功能、修改UI界面,或者增减某些业务逻辑等等。小程序二次开发
2023-05-26
微信小程序开发工具上传
微信小程序是一种轻量级应用程序,它可以运行在微信客户端上,并且可以不用下载和安装即可使用。在微信小程序的开发过程中,上传小程序是非常关键的一个步骤,因为只有通过上传,才能让小程序可以被用户使用。本文将介绍微信小程序开发工具上传的原理以及详细过程。1. 原理
2023-05-26